Flanigan's Seafood Bar and GrillB

330 Southern Blvd, West Palm Beach, FL 33405 · Bar & grill, American restaurant, Family restaurant

Reliable ribs, wings, and seafood in a lively sports-bar setting with big portions and value deals, but service consistency and management interactions can be hit-or-miss.

Our take

Flanigan's Seafood Bar and Grill delivers solid neighborhood dining with strong food quality in its signature ribs, wings, and fried shrimp, backed by genuine customer loyalty and generous portions. However, inconsistent execution across visits and isolated but serious food safety reports prevent a higher grade, while the variable service quality and casual sports-bar setting lack the polish of premier establishments. It's a reliable go-to for comfort food and family dining, but not a destination restaurant.

In more detail

Think classic South Florida grill with big plates and bigger personality: TVs glow overhead, fishing trophies line the walls, and servers like Gypsy or Nick keep things moving with friendly hustle. One diner summed it up: "Comfort food, quick, and plenty to share." Do expect a lively bar scene and, at peak, a wait at the host stand that can feel less than warmly welcoming. The cooking leans hearty and familiar rather than fancy: ribs and wings are the crowd favorites, fried shrimp lands crispy, and burgers scratch that game-day itch. Seafood like mahi can be hit-or-miss on freshness and portion, while meal deals and late-night hours keep regulars returning. This is a place for comfort-first cravings, not culinary theatrics. Families are very welcome here. There is a real kids menu at $6.99 with burgers, nuggets, mac and cheese, and even kid-sized ribs, so there is plenty for picky eaters. Portions are generous, servers are used to groups, and the sports-bar energy means a little noise is fine. Just steer younger diners toward the kids section and burgers/pasta if seafood feels too adventurous.
